Frequently Asked Questions
What is the DegreeOutlook Score for Fine Arts at University of Massachusetts-Amherst?
A score of 24/100 indicates below-average financial outcomes for Fine Arts. Earnings, ROI, or AI risk factors are pulling the score down.
Is Fine Arts at University of Massachusetts-Amherst worth the student debt?
Median debt of $22,375 against $18,072/yr starting salary means roughly 1.2 years of earnings go to repayment. That's above average — financial aid and loan terms matter here.
Can you still earn well with Fine Arts from University of Massachusetts-Amherst?
First-year earnings trail the national median, but starting salary isn't the full picture. Regional cost of living, career trajectory, and tuition cost all factor in. Check the five-year earnings data when available.
